On June 17, 2021, several students including teachers of FGC Birnin-Yauri were abducted from their school by gunmen. Ka’oje said the students, identified as Aliya Abubakar, Esther Sunday, and Elizabeth Ogechi-Kwafor, were set free by their kidnappers on Sunday evening but arrived in Kebbi on Monday. “The three girls were released on Sunday evening by their abductors but they arrived in Kebbi on Monday afternoon,” NAN quoted Ka’oje as saying. “Yes, they released three of the school girls to us on Sunday evening. They are already with the state government. “The remaining four girls out of the seven are still in the hands of the bandits.”Since the abduction in 2021, some students have been rescued by troops of the Nigerian Army while many others were reportedly released after a ransom was paid to their captors. The gunmen later released 27 of the students and an additional 30 were set free after seven months in captivity. Recently, four of the students regained freedom after being held captive for about two years.
